摘要
Graphite crystals have been synthesized with high productivities at low temperatures from ethylene decomposition on cobalt ferrite nanoparticles. The crude material, that consists in iron-cobalt alloyed nanoparticles dispersed in the graphitic structure, presents ferromagnetic behavior. A simple HCl washing yeilds to pure graphitic flakes. The results show a remarkable support effect as MWNT are produced if cobalt ferrite particles are supported on alumina.
